But I can confidently say that the Lacto-Sica foam is truly an ideal cleanser. Being slightly acidic, it doesn't dry out the skin while still maintaining excellent cleansing effectiveness. After rinsing, it doesn't leave a slippery feeling nor does it make your skin feel too tight. It's a cleanser that gives you that 'my skin isn't dry... but it feels thoroughly cleansed' sensation. When used as a first-step cleanser, it removes sunscreen effectively, though it won't completely remove mascara or heavy makeup on its own.
ConsIt's on the pricier side, and if you're expecting that squeaky-clean feeling typical of alkaline cleansers that remove all makeup, you might be disappointed. If you approach it with the understanding that this is the level of cleansing power an acidic cleanser can achieve, you'll likely find it to be a very satisfying product.

TipLet's break down the pros and cons one by one. The good points: First off, it's passed sensitivity tests and has an EWG Green rating, which is a great selling point, especially for an app like Hwahae. For those concerned about skin issues and blemishes, safe ingredients and low irritation are crucial factors to consider. I found it easy to use for both light morning cleansing and as a final evening cleanse, largely due to its gentle formulation. The hydration is excellent, which works well for my combination dehydrated skin. You know that feeling when your skin starts tightening right after washing? This cleanser noticeably reduces that sensation. Must be the power of Lactocica! The not-so-good points: Let's talk about some drawbacks. Firstly, this is more about low pH cleansers in general. Like other top-rated low pH cleansers on Hwahae, don't expect that squeaky-clean, deep-scrubbing feeling. Low pH cleansers don't give you that 'stripped' sensation and don't aggressively remove dead skin cells. Instead, they preserve skin moisture. You'll need to be diligent with your cleansing routine to manage dead skin cells. This might suit conscientious adults but requires more effort from the lazy among us.
